Transaction 5cc776f5330d21cb3d7a955b065fdcbd6fbfce90c62d0b426ca7054c4f562021

1 Input
2 Outputs
  • 5cc776f5330d21cb3d7a955b065fdcbd6fbfce90c62d0b426ca7054c4f562021:0
  • value  17742680
    address  1J5McrcQnNw6NUbeqrSUtZmKXe2yycr9s7
  • 5cc776f5330d21cb3d7a955b065fdcbd6fbfce90c62d0b426ca7054c4f562021:1
  • value  1250460
    address  14zPRpNaVSpfafevkRh1SR3SsyRSe3PPeW